Several medicines have their possible side effects that can affect you in different ways. Following are some of the potential effects that are associated with co-codamol. Also, just because we have listed these side effects here, it does not mean that all of you consuming co-codamol will definitely experience them. Let us know talk about the side effect it may cause:
- It can slow down your digestive tract and end up causing constipation.
- Nausea and vomiting.
- Drowsiness or a sensation of unconsciousness or spinning
- Codeine can also cause dizziness. Also, the dosage of the medicine must be bought, with a proper prescription by your physician.
- You can feel confused if you are consuming co-codamol for a long time.
- Sweating
- Skin-related problems like itching or rash
- Dehydration and dry mouth.
- Loss of appetite
- Urinary retention
- Pancreatitis
- Abdominal Pain
- Difficulty in breathing
- Lastly, you can get addicted to the medicine id you take it regularly or for longer periods of time.

What happens if you take Co-Codamol in excess?
- Remember, an excessive intake of Co-Codamol can be very dangerous or fatal. The medicine is capable of causing some serious harm to your liver and kidneys due to the contents of paracetamol added to it.
- You should not to exceed the recommended dosage either prescribed by your physician or stated in the information leaflet that comes along with the medicine. Avoid taking any other medicine or painkiller that contains paracetamol as its base content, as this can easily result in the overdosage of the same.
- Always get immediate help if you or any other person you know has consumed Co-Codomal more than recommended, even if you feel normal. If delayed the medicine can cause some serious liver or kidney related problems.
